Shock Absorber Wireline Pressure Gauge Hanger
I. Overview:
In the wire work, the shock absorber is used to reduce the
vibration transmitted to the instrument when running in.
The shock absorber is basically composed of a salvage neck, a
cylinder, an auxiliary spring, a mandrel, a main spring, a plug
cap, and a lower joint. The main spring is stronger because it has
to bear the weight of its lower instrument and is in a constant
compression state. The mandrel moves between the springs and
absorbs shocks, thereby protecting the downhole state of the
instrument.
II. Technical parameters:
Size | Fishing neck | upper Connection | Lower Connection |
1.25″ | 1.187″ | 15/16-10UN | 3/4-16UN |
1.5″ | 1.375″ | 15/16-10UN | 3/4-16UN |
1.75″ | 1.375″ | 15/16-10UN | 3/4-16UN |
1.875″ | 1.75″ | 15/16-10UN | 3/4-16UN |
2″ | 1.75″ | 15/16-10UN | 3/4-16UN |
2.5″ | 2.313″ | 15/16-10UN | 3/4-16UN |
III. matters needing attention:
1. When using, carefully check whether the parts are well connected
and whether the mandrel can be moved, in case the shock absorber
cannot be used after going down the well.
2. When not in use temporarily, apply lubricating oil to the thread
and place it with a protective wire.
